Runbook: Shorecast tide-table widget. If the widget shows stale tides, first check the harvester job — it pulls predictions nightly and usually just needs a rerun. If the rerun hangs, the culprit is almost always the tide archive being locked by a stuck reindex. Kill the reindex, then restart the harvester pointed at the archive database using the connection string below.

replica DSN, tawef-hahap: mysql://eliix_svc:FiIC0jz@db-394a.lumiclabs.internal:5432/holius

Handover: Customer Dedup Job (Tallowmere)

Nightly dedup merges duplicate customer records by fuzzy match on name plus postcode. Job runs 02:00; failures page on-call. Most failures are lock contention — just rerun. If the merge-audit store reports "encrypted, no session," the job restarted mid-run and dropped its key; you must unseal the store manually before rerunning or merges won't be reversible. Unseal from the admin CLI. It prompts for the recovery passphrase, which is below.

vault phrase of tawig-taduf = zorath-oliwyn

## Runbook: Moving Lanternkit to Hermeta builds

Okay, this is the scary-sounding step that's actually fine. Flip the pipeline flag `hermeta_enabled`, then kick a dry-run build — it should produce bit-identical artifacts to last week's release. If checksums diverge, don't promote; ping build-eng and revert the flag. Cache hits will be cold on the first run, so budget an extra 25 minutes. Once the dry run matches, re-sign the artifacts, since Hermeta's sealed toolchain won't accept the legacy credentials. Sign with the following key.

signing key of bagap-yawep = bky13_TbfT6ZMUoGJo2

MINUTES — Management Meeting

Subject: Closure of the Farrow Creek Office

Attendees agreed the Farrow Creek branch will close at quarter-end. Lease obligations expire naturally; no penalty applies. Staff of six will be offered transfers to the Kestrel Bay office or severance per policy. Branch managers should route client questions to Dela Norwick until further notice. The confidential transition plan is recorded below.

confidential, kajof-tahof: The pricing group signed off on a budget of $491.8 million for Project Casvan.